Atmospheric scientists have now found a novel way of … WebAug 28, 2024 · All you have to do is take a straight-sided can with a flat bottom (like a cylinder), make marks up its side every inch, set it out in the open, and wait for rain. If you see that the can has filled with water up to the 1 inch mark, then you know it has rained 1 inch. Up to the 2 inch mark, it has rained 2 inches.

WebJan 3, 2024 · How do meteorologists measure rainfall depth? Meteorologists and hydrologists use rain gauges to measure the amount of liquid precipitation over an area during a predefined period. A rain gauge is also known as a pluviometer, udometer, ombrometer, or hyetometer. WebMar 28, 2024 · The most effective way to do this is by lifting the air. WebMeasuring and reporting solid precipitation Four values should be measured when reporting solid precipitation. They are: oSnowfall:Maximum amount of new snow that has fallen since the previous observation. oSnow Depth:The total depth of snow (including any ice) on the ground at the normal observation time.
